How he got here
Kunal played the stammering Varun in Remix, but not many people know that he was also a child actor in the show Rajni. Kunal then played the care-a-damn cadet Yudi in Left Right Left.  Kunal had no qualms playing a rough around the edges antagonist called Angad in the show Mann Ki Awaaz Pratigya. But Kunal won over the audience in the role of a reckless but golden hearted reporter Mohan, who fell in love with a widow, Megha. The rest is, to employ a cliché-history.Kunal Karan Kapoor

What makes Kunal stand out
Most successes are measured in tangible milestones, but Kunal’s popularity can be measured in the amount of love that his fans have for him. His impact can be measured in the fact that Na Bole Tum Na Maine Kuchh Kaha has been one of the only shows on Indian television to have a second season on public demand. In May 2013, Kunal set his popularity in concrete as he won the ITA Best Actor Award.Kunal Karan Kapoor

About this win, he said “It feels great to have won something as I never won anything, not even in school. But the win belongs to the show, the writers who have written the character and the audience.” Not just that, Kunal also set a new trend in tellyland when he trended on Twitter for 24 hours on his birthday, which was a very special gift to him by his loyal fans, apart from the cartload (literally) of gifts that he got from his fans all over the world.
